‘Iftaar Meri Taraf Se’ campaign of Tiffin Aaw garners applause in Srinagar

Mar 29, 2023

Srinagar, March 29 (ANI): A Srinagar-based food service ‘Tiffin Aaw’ started a free food distribution initiative ‘Iftaar Meri Taraf Se’ in Srinagar. They distribute free food at the time of Iftar and Sehri, especially in hospitals and other places. Rayees Ahmad, who is the owner of Tiffin Aaw, started this homemade food service three years ago. He distributed food in hospitals during COVID-19 which was appreciated all over. Now the holy month of Ramadan is going on worldwide, and Muslims keep fasting during this day. They take the food at 4:30 am, called Sehri and break the fast at 6:45 pm, called Iftar. At these times, many people in hospitals and other busy places face problems in taking meals exactly at Sehri and Iftaar time. Tiffin Aaw gives them free food. Many people also approach them and donate to them for their services. People also call them for their services at night hours. They gave their services 24x7 in Srinagar city and if any needy person calls them then they deliver their food to home. People appreciated the initiative of free food distribution and appealed to others to come forward to support this type of initiative in Kashmir, especially during Ramadan.
